wood burning stoves 2.0*
The moose likes Programmer Certification (SCJP/OCPJP) and the fly likes get method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of EJB 3 in Action this week in the EJB and other Java EE Technologies forum!
JavaRanch » Java Forums » Certification » Programmer Certification (SCJP/OCPJP)
Bookmark "get method" Watch "get method" New topic
Author

get method

weiliu lili
Ranch Hand

Joined: Apr 11, 2002
Posts: 46
public class Sandys{
private int court;
public static void main(String argv[]){
Sandys s = new Sandys(99);
System.out.println(s.court);
}
Sandys(int ballcount){
court=ballcount;
}
}
</b>
The result:Compilation and run with an output of 99
i thought private instance variable should be matched with a get method
,in this case getCourt{},so when should i define a get method in a class?
Asif Mahmood
Greenhorn

Joined: Jun 11, 2001
Posts: 29
Out must be 99...
court is an instance variable and is automatically initialized with 0. In the constructor of Sandys, court is initialized with 99. and no getCourt method is required.
Best regards,
-Asif
Thomas Kijftenbelt
Ranch Hand

Joined: Feb 13, 2002
Posts: 73
Hi,
Normally get and set methods are used to access private (encapsulated) variables from another class.
Greetings,
TK
SCJP
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: get method
 
Similar Threads
Marcus Green #3 Q45
Marcus Green exam question
Help for the visibility of private access modifier
private member doubt
Sample question